LED light strips are the chameleons of architectural lighting—flexible, durable, and endlessly adaptable. At Coloria, we've curated a range of LED strips designed to meet the diverse needs of modern construction, from residential interiors to commercial exteriors. What sets our products apart? It's the blend of technology, sustainability, and real-world practicality. Let's explore some of our most sought-after series:
| Product Series | Key Applications | Standout Features | Sustainability Edge |
|---|---|---|---|
| FlexiGlow Pro | Residential kitchens, accent walls, furniture lighting | Waterproof (IP67), cuttable every 5cm, 50,000-hour lifespan | 90+ CRI (color rendering index), 12V low voltage (energy-efficient) |
| FacadeMaster | Commercial building exteriors, architectural outlines | UV-resistant, -30°C to 60°C operating range, RGBW color mixing | RoHS compliant, mercury-free, 80% energy savings vs. traditional neon |
| MedSafe LED | Hospitals, schools, healthcare facilities | Class A fireproof rating, anti-microbial coating, dimmable | Meets LEED v4 criteria for green building certification |
| OutdoorXtreme | Landscaping, pool edges, outdoor patios | IP68 waterproof, impact-resistant (IK10), solar-rechargeable options | Solar-compatible models reduce grid dependency |
Take our MedSafe LED series, for instance. Designed specifically for hospitals and schools, these strips aren't just bright—they're built to protect. The Class A fireproof CPL inorganic board backing ensures safety in high-traffic areas, while the anti-microbial coating prevents the spread of germs. For a recent school project in Jeddah, this series became a game-changer: it met strict local fire codes, reduced maintenance costs (thanks to its 50,000-hour lifespan), and contributed to the project's sustainability credits under Saudi Arabia's LEED-aligned green building standards.
